23. Intentional Parenting: Habits for Healthier Families
Let’s face it, parenting is hard.
When you’re in the trenches of parenting, you need all the help you can get. Sometimes we get stuck just trying to survive the day when we know we should be more intentional in our parenting.
But how do we do that?
In this episode you'll learn:
what to teach your kids, how to do it, and what ultimately matters
more about family mantras—crafting a list of values and statements for your family
checking in with your spouse for family meetings
making fun a priority
Listen as Katy Epling and Sara R.Ward dive into a conversation on what intentional parenting is and how to take small steps toward being more intentional with your kids.
We include books, resources and great conversation starters for you and your whole family.

22. Keys to Building a Strong Marriage
Being intentional in your marriage is challenging no matter whether you’ve been married one year or fifty.
Today's guest is Laura Thomas, who is an author of both romantic suspense novels and Christian nonfiction (and many more). She is passionate about working on her marriage and writing love stories in her romantic suspense novels.
We want to help you build a marriage you can celebrate and rest in. Listen in as Laura shares:
how to work on your marriage in all seasons
her best marriage advice (which is spot on!)
how to have date nights when you don’t have money or time
how to honor and love your husband well
who you should surround yourself with to encourage your marriage (hint: it might surprise you!)
Bonus: She also shares her favorite love stories!

21. How to Begin and Maintain a Bible Reading Habit
If you’ve struggled to stick with a Bible reading habit, or you want to know how to start, today we’re talking about practical tips for incorporating it into our schedules all year long.
Our guest today is Eva Kubasiak. She is passionate about breaking down the barriers to Bible study so beginners can learn and love God's Word.
We talk about:
—how to find time for a new habit
—the difference between Bible reading and study
—what to do if you’ve fallen off the wagon with your reading goal
—how to read through the Bible in a year.
This episode is packed with good tips, great resources and sticking with a habit that's vital to our faith: reading God's Word.

18. How to Create a Meaningful Christmas This Year
Are you looking for ways to create smaller, more memorable holiday traditions this year? Today, I have ten ways for you to create a meaningful Christmas in the midst of a different kind of holiday season.
This is the year to discover new traditions or revitalize old ones. Instead of seeing what you can’t do, we can see the birth of Christ in a new way and make special memories with our families.
These 10 ideas are meant to help you think about the why behind your own traditions and give you a new focus on hope this year.
Here are 10 ideas to help you create a memorable Christmas including:
How we can pivot our traditions or make new ones
Managing expectations when things don’t go as expected
How to keep your sense of humor over the holidays
How to reframe the season
Keeping your focus on Jesus and my favorite Advent resources.
